Digital Global Systems Achieves $18B Patent Portfolio Valuation

Amid Record Patent Momentum and Accelerated Issuances

Published on Feb. 26, 2026

Digital Global Systems (DGS), a pioneer in AI-driven RF Awareness and spectrum optimization, announced that its patent portfolio was independently valued at approximately $18 billion as of November 2025. The company has continued adding new patent issuances and filings, further strengthening the depth and strategic value of its intellectual property.

The details

DGS's portfolio now stands at 571 U.S. issued or allowed patents, 144 U.S. pending applications, and 10 foreign patents, totaling 725 assets (up from 650 as of December 31, 2025). The company has received 31 Notices of Allowance in February 2026 alone, indicating a steady stream of new patent issuances. DGS's AI-driven inventions cover autonomous RF awareness, data fusion, and intelligent optimization technologies that are widely applicable across industries.
